How specific gear motor architectures adapt to varying physical demands across commercial, domestic, and industrial applications.
Smart lock assemblies require compact gear motors capable of delivering high starting torque within a small form factor. Operating on low-voltage battery power, these locks need gearboxes with high mechanical efficiency to maximize battery life. The integration of precision steel-cut gears and customized gear ratios (e.g., 1:150, 1:298) allows N20 brushed gear motors to reliably actuate locking pins under variable friction loads.
Medical dosing pumps and wearable linear actuators require high precision and low noise. Miniature planetary gearboxes paired with brushless motors ensure stable, incremental dosing and low vibrational output. By integrating magnetic encoders, medical devices receive real-time shaft rotation data, allowing control algorithms to verify position and ensure patient safety.
For high-load consumer applications, such as children's ride-on vehicles and RC crawler crawlers, cost efficiency and thermal endurance are critical. The brushed 555 DC motor series remains a popular choice due to its high speed, robust torque output, and reliability under start-stop cycles. Integrated fan cooling and high-density copper windings help protect these motors against thermal degradation during extended play.

Planetary gearboxes share load across multiple planet gears, delivering higher torque density, efficiency, and resistance to impact loads compared to spur gearboxes. This makes them ideal for space-constrained applications like medical equipment and miniature robotics. Spur gearboxes are generally preferred for lower-load, cost-sensitive applications.

Yes. Standard motors are rated for -10°C to +60°C. For extreme low temperatures (down to -40°C), we configure the assembly with low-viscosity synthetic lubricants, specialized bearing seals, and low-temperature wire insulation to prevent grease freezing and mechanical binding.
At speeds up to 10,000 RPM, minor rotor imbalances generate vibration, noise, and bearing wear. We run every high-speed rotor through automated balance instruments to minimize runout, ensuring quieter operation and a longer service life in precision applications.
